Wheat Kings visit the Moose Jaw Warriors tonight

Brandon looking to end a three-game winless streak

Image - Submitted

The Wheat Kings travel to Moose Jaw to take on the Warriors tonight (Mar 1).

Coming in to tonight's game - the Wheat Kings dropped two games to the Regina Pats. Last Friday (Feb 24), the Pats stole one inside a packed Westoba Place with the Wheat Kings putting 47 shots on Drew Sim only for him to surrender 3 goals. Connor Bedard would score the game winning goal with only 1:55 remaining in the 3rd period allowing the Pats to win 4-3 in hostile territory. The following night (Feb 25) the Wheat Kings lost 6-3 in Regina. It was a game the Wheat Kings controlled for most of it heading into the 2nd period with a 3-1 lead, but penalty trouble gave the Pats life scoring a pair in the 2nd period and then adding a late 2nd period goal from Alexander Suzdalev giving the Pats a 4-3 lead after 40. Alex Suzdalev would put the game to bed scoring his first career hat trick and Connor Bedard would add the empty net goal giving the Pats a 6-3 win.

The Wheat Kings and Warriors are meeting for the 6th time this season. The Warriors lead the season series 3-2 after the Wheat Kings had an early 2-0 lead up to December 31st.  Last time these two clubs met was back on January 27th, it was a 5-1 victory for the Warriors. In that specific game it was the Wheat Kings who got off to a hot start with Calder Anderson getting on the board 83 seconds into the game but the Warriors took over the remainder of the way scoring 5 unanswered. Ryder Korczak & Harper Lolacher led the way each with a pair of goals. The Warriors have outsourced 15-6 in the last 3 games combined. Ryder Korczak has been the difference in those games with 4 goals and an assist. Korczak was  Jagger Firkus has 4 goals and 6 assists in those 3 games. Nolan Ritchie has been the impact player for the Wheat Kings in the season series scoring 8 points in 5 games versus the Warriors.

Who’s Hot: Brett Hyland currently has 19 goals scored in his last 21 games. Forward Nate Danielson has been stellar as of late scoring 11 points in his last 8 games. Danielson is also on a 8 game point streak.. Nolan Ritchie has 45 points in his last 35 games.
